Accelerators hasten the hydration (hardening) of the concrete. Common resources made use of are calcium chloride, calcium nitrate and sodium nitrate. Even so, usage of chlorides might bring about corrosion in metal reinforcing and it is prohibited in a few nations, to make sure that nitrates might be favored, Though They can be a lot less effective as opposed to chloride salt.

Crystalline admixtures are typically extra during batching from the concrete to lessen permeability. The reaction usually takes location when subjected to h2o and un-hydrated cement particles to type insoluble needle-shaped crystals, which fill capillary pores and micro-cracks during the concrete to block pathways for water and waterborne contaminates.

Intensely loaded concrete ground slabs and pavements may be sensitive to cracking and subsequent traffic-pushed deterioration. Subsequently, prestressed concrete is regularly Employed in these constructions as its pre-compression offers the concrete with the chance to resist the crack-inducing tensile stresses created by in-support loading. This crack resistance also will allow specific slab sections to become produced in bigger pours than for conventionally strengthened concrete, resulting in wider joint spacings, minimized jointing fees and fewer prolonged-time period joint upkeep difficulties.
Unbonded put up-tensioning differs from bonded put up-tensioning by letting the tendons long-lasting liberty of longitudinal motion relative to your concrete. This is often mostly accomplished by encasing Each and every specific tendon factor within a plastic sheathing crammed with a corrosion-inhibiting grease, commonly lithium-based.
